Frontier Airlines announces new Austin-Kansas City non-stop service

AUSTIN, TEXAS – Frontier Airlines has announced it will inaugurate nonstop service between Austin and Kansas City, Mo., starting November 18, 2010.

“We're excited to add new nonstop service to Kansas City and through service to Milwaukee,” said Daniel Shurz, Frontier VP of strategy and planning. “This service provides access to more of the over 70 destinations that Frontier serves."

The new flight will depart Austin-Bergstrom daily, except on Sundays, at 8:10 a.m. and arrive in Kansas City at 10 a.m. The return flight will depart Kansas City daily, except on Saturdays, at 6:59 p.m. and arrive in Austin at 8:54 p.m., all times local. This new route will be flown by the carrier’s Embraer 170 aircraft. The 76-seat E170 features comfortable two-by-two all leather seating. The carrier’s E170 and E190 aircraft will be outfitted with inflight internet service by fall 2010.

About Frontier Airlines
Frontier Airlines is a wholly owned subsidiary of Republic Airways Holdings, Inc., an airline holding company that owns Chautauqua Airlines, Lynx Aviation, Midwest Airlines, Republic Airlines and Shuttle America. Currently in its 16th year of operations, Frontier employs more than 5,500 aviation professionals and operates more than 550 daily flights from its hubs at Denver International Airport and Milwaukee’s General Mitchell International Airport. Frontier offers routes to more than 70 destinations in the United States, Mexico and Costa Rica.

On April 13, 2010, Republic Airways announced that its two branded carriers, Frontier and Midwest, would combine under the Frontier Airlines name. The integration of these two airlines is expected to take 12-18 months. Track the progress at FrontierMidwest.com.

Austin-Bergstrom International Airport is ranked as the best in customer service in North America and second among airports its size around the globe by the Airports Council International (ACI) Airport Service Quality Survey. Austin-Bergstrom has nonstop service to 38 destinations in the U.S. and served 8.2 million passengers in 2009.
